WebAs the sound waves bounce off internal organs, fluids and tissues, the sensitive receiver in the transducer records tiny changes in the sound's pitch and direction. A computer instantly measures these signature waves and displays them as real-time pictures on a monitor. Web8 aug. 2024 · These vibrations, or sound waves, carry a tiny amount of force. Although the force of sound is weak, it can move small objects when used in just the right way. Scientists call this acoustophoresis (Ah-KOO-stoh-for-EE-sis). Web24 nov. 2024 · There are two big properties that describe sound waves: frequency and amplitude. Frequency Frequency is how quickly the wave is moving. Is it a quick vibration that created the sound, or a slow one? Frequency impacts pitch. A fast frequency will create a higher pitch.
